Transaction 143950c6bbab39c6821d1f38fa12520685b9e913b5448657cb7f9434d31ec0f6
1 Input
1 Output
-
143950c6bbab39c6821d1f38fa12520685b9e913b5448657cb7f9434d31ec0f6:0
- value
- 16312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24941a4401c257f8da7230be2965f91770468ec0 OP_EQUAL
- address
- 352RfoH88hnyQRPmvyshMiHLi2pRRz9fFF